
River Hills/Lake Wylie Lions Club is making a world of difference
The River Hills / Lake Wylie Lions Club serves those in need in the entire Lake Wylie & Clover area.
Yearly charitable contributions exceed $100K and thousands of volunteer hours.
Our funds are derived from the generous support of local businesses and individuals involved in various fundraising and community service projects.

Richard (Dick) Lewis, a 37-year member of the River Hills/Lake Wylie Lions Club, was inducted into the South Carolina Lions Club Hall of Fame during the annual meeting in Spartanburg—an honor marking a first for his club. Nominated by club president Don Nowak, Lewis was recognized for decades of service, joining an elite group of only about 120 members honored statewide over the past 60 years.

Our Pancake Breakfast at Camp Thunderbird is not so much a fundraiser as it is a thank you to the entire Lake Wylie community for their support of Lions Club functions. The children visit with Father Christmas and enjoy other activities like pony rides, face painting and air filled party bouncer structures. It has been well-attended and the well-fed participants look forward to coming back. This is a reverse-charge event where the small admission costs are greater for the kids than the adults.
